Former Deputy Chairman of the Kosovo War Veterans Organization (OVL UÇK), Nasim Haradinaj, announced that today in The Hague – Scheveningen, a special and noisy event will take place.
Haradinaj shared on his official social media profile that Albanian motorcyclists who departed from Prekaz to march to The Hague in support of justice for former UÇK leaders have arrived at their destination.
He emphasized that the roar of the motorcycles will be heard even in the cells of the accused:
“This morning we began regrouping the motorcyclists for the ride to The Hague… They are joining and rejoining, and today in Den Haag Scheveningen will be a special and loud day… The thunder of the motorcycles will be heard in the cells of our freedom fighters and beyond!”
The event is part of the platform “Freedom Has a Name”, where around 150 Albanian motorcyclists from Kosovo and across Europe began the march on motorcycles to demand justice for former UÇK leaders currently on trial in The Hague.
